What is the coordination number and geometry of a complex made up of a trivalent actinide, Am(III), and six ligands with five unpaired electrons in the outermost shell?

The coordination number of a complex refers to the number of ligands attached to the central metal ion. In this case, the complex is made up of a trivalent actinide, Am III , and six ligands. Therefore, the coordination number is 6.The geometry of a complex depends on the coordination number and the arrangement of the ligands around the central metal ion. For a coordination number of 6, the most common geometry is octahedral. In an octahedral geometry, the six ligands are arranged around the central metal ion with 90-degree angles between them.So, the coordination number of the complex is 6, and its geometry is octahedral.
